Layering Ingredients: How This Affects the Cooking Process and Flavor Infusion

When it comes to slow cooking, the order in which you layer your ingredients plays a pivotal role in flavor development. Start with the heartier items at the bottom, such as the chicken and beans. This allows them to absorb the flavors of the spices and the liquids that will be added later. Next, add the chopped onions, garlic, and bell peppers. These aromatics will release their essential oils as they cook, infusing the dish with a rich depth of flavor. Finally, place the pumpkin puree on top to keep it from browning too much and to help it meld beautifully with the rest of the ingredients.

Layering in this way not only enhances the taste but also ensures an even cooking process. The chicken stays moist, and the vegetables soften perfectly, creating a harmonious blend of flavors that will make your chili unforgettable.

Adding Liquids and Spices: Ensuring Flavors Meld Together During Slow Cooking

Once your ingredients are layered, it’s time to add the liquids and spices. For this recipe, a combination of low-sodium chicken broth and a splash of cream or cream cheese will provide the necessary moisture and creaminess. Pour in enough broth to just cover the ingredients; this will allow the chili to simmer gently without becoming too soupy.

When it comes to spices, this is where your chili can truly shine. A mix of cumin, chili powder, paprika, and a hint of cinnamon can elevate the chili’s profile. Don’t forget to add a touch of salt and pepper to taste. Stir the spices in gently, ensuring they are evenly distributed throughout the chili. The slow cooking process will meld these flavors beautifully, creating a warm and inviting aroma that fills your kitchen.

Slow Cooking Process: Tips on Timing and Temperature Settings for Optimal Results

The beauty of a slow cooker lies in its ability to transform raw ingredients into a tender, flavor-packed dish with minimal effort. Set your slow cooker on low for about 6 to 8 hours. If you’re in a hurry, you can set it on high for 3 to 4 hours, but the low setting will yield the best results in terms of flavor and texture.

It’s crucial to keep the lid closed during cooking to maintain the heat and moisture inside. If you’re tempted to peek, remember that each time you lift the lid, you extend the cooking time by about 15 minutes. Patience is key here—allowing the chili to simmer slowly will ensure the chicken becomes tender and the flavors meld perfectly.

Shredding the Chicken: Techniques for Achieving the Best Texture

Once the cooking time is complete, the next step is to shred the chicken. This can be done easily with two forks or, for a quick method, by using a hand mixer on low speed. Shredding the chicken while it is still in the slow cooker allows it to soak up more of the chili sauce, adding to the overall flavor.

When shredding, aim for a mix of larger pieces and finer shreds to provide a nice texture contrast in the final dish. Be sure to stir the shredded chicken back into the chili, allowing it to absorb the creamy sauce.

Tips for Incorporating Cream Cheese Smoothly Into the Chili

To incorporate cream cheese smoothly, cut it into cubes and add it to the slow cooker about 30 minutes before serving. Stir it in well and let it melt into the chili, stirring occasionally. This will prevent clumping and ensure a creamy consistency throughout.

If you prefer a lower-fat or dairy-free option, consider substituting the cream cheese with a plant-based cream cheese or cashew cream. Blending soaked cashews with a bit of almond milk can provide a similar creamy texture without the dairy.

Suggestions for Meal Prep or Freezing Leftovers for Future Meals

This chili is perfect for meal prep. Store leftovers in airtight containers in the refrigerator for up to 3 days or freeze for up to 3 months. When reheating, add a splash of chicken broth to loosen the chili, as it may thicken in the fridge or freezer.

Slow Cooker Creamy Pumpkin Chicken Chili

Embrace the flavors of fall with the Harvest Harmony: Slow Cooker Creamy Pumpkin Chicken Chili. This comforting dish combines tender chicken, creamy pumpkin, and a blend of spices, creating a warm meal perfect for chilly evenings. Packed with nutrients from seasonal ingredients, this chili offers both health benefits and deliciousness. Plus, the slow cooker makes preparation effortless, allowing you to enjoy a nourishing dinner with minimal fuss. Perfect for family gatherings or cozy nights in!

Ingredients

1 lb (450g) boneless, skinless chicken breasts

1 can (15 oz) pumpkin puree

1 can (15 oz) black beans, drained and rinsed

1 can (15 oz) kidney beans, drained and rinsed

1 medium onion, finely diced

2 cloves garlic, minced

1 red bell pepper, diced

1 cup corn (fresh, frozen, or canned)

2 cups chicken broth

1 tsp ground cumin

1 tsp smoked paprika

1 tsp chili powder

½ tsp ground cinnamon

Salt and pepper, to taste

½ cup cream cheese, softened

1 cup shredded cheddar cheese (optional, for topping)

Fresh cilantro, for garnish (optional)

Instructions

Prep the Chicken: Place the boneless, skinless chicken breasts at the bottom of the slow cooker.

    Layer the Ingredients: Add the pumpkin puree, drained black beans, kidney beans, diced onion, minced garlic, diced red bell pepper, and corn on top of the chicken.

      Add Liquids and Spices: Pour the chicken broth over the layered ingredients. Sprinkle in the ground cumin, smoked paprika, chili powder, ground cinnamon, salt, and pepper. Stir gently to combine, ensuring the chicken is submerged in the liquid.

        Slow Cook: Cover the slow cooker and c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 4 hours, until the chicken is cooked through and tender.

          Shred the Chicken: Once cooked, remove the chicken breasts from the slow cooker and shred them using two forks. Return the shredded chicken back into the chili and stir.

            Make it Creamy: Add the softened cream cheese to the slow cooker. Stir until well combined, creating a creamy texture throughout the chili. Allow it to heat through for about 10-15 minutes on low.

              Serve: Ladle the chili into bowls, and if desired, top with shredded cheddar cheese and fresh cilantro for a burst of flavor.

                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 20 minutes | 6-8 hours | Serves 6-8
